Florida-based Universal Insurance Holdings Inc. reported that the Indiana Department of Insurance has approved the homeowners insurance forms of its wholly-owned subsidiary, Universal Property & Casualty Insurance Co. (UPCIC), and that UPCIC has subsequently written its first homeowners insurance policy in Indiana.
In addition to Florida, UPCIC is fully licensed to offer its homeowners insurance products in Delaware, Georgia, Hawaii, Indiana,Maryland, Massachusetts, North Carolina,Pennsylvania and South Carolina.
